Description

A bee house for solitary wild bees — mason bees, leafcutter bees, and other cavity-nesting species. Designed to be filled with natural nesting tubes (reed, bamboo, or cardboard), not printed ones. Features a removable woodpecker guard and wall mounting.

 

This is the World Bee Day 2026 edition. I plan to release updated versions as I learn more from real-world use.

 

Features:

  • Closed back wall — nesting tubes are sealed at one end, as bees require
  • Removable woodpecker guard (separate print, glued together, inserts from the top)
  • Wall mounting holes (keyhole style)
  • Ventilation holes on the top left and right sides

Nesting tubes (not included): Use natural reed stems, bamboo, or cardboard tubes — 6–8 mm inner diameter, 150 mm long, available online or from garden stores. Mason bees (active in spring) prefer 8 mm tubes, leafcutter bees (active in summer) prefer 6 mm. A mix of sizes attracts more species.


Printed in PETG.
